Key Takeaways: Addressing Challenges and Embracing the Future

  1. The deconstruction of jobs into tasks emerged as a critical theme. The discussion touched upon the partial or total atomization, augmentation, and automation of jobs. This nuanced perspective revealed the complexity of addressing workforce challenges.
  2. Bert Van Rompaey emphasized that companies should look at work in a more granular way and evolve their approach to HR towards a future proof skills-based strategy to navigate the future of work. 
  3. Companies will continue to face labor market scarcity which will impact businesses in many ways. 
  4. Technology will play a huge role in transforming the role of human resources highlighting the strategic role of HR professionals in developing an organization’s competitive advantage.
